The call
Homeowner says the air handler is blowing but the house has been getting warmer since yesterday afternoon.
- Equipment
- 3-ton R-410A split system, 9 years old, single-stage condenser, gas furnace air handler
- Ambient
- 36 °C
- Site notes
- Thermostat is set to COOL at 22 °C, space is 29 °C. Indoor blower runs. Outdoor unit is silent when you walk up to it.
Decision 1 of 4
You are standing at the outdoor unit on a 36 °C afternoon. Nothing is turning.
What is your first action?
